1) Egg Frittata Cups

A muffin pan filled with individual egg frittata cups fresh from the oven, surrounded by colorful vegetables and herbs

Egg frittata cups are a tasty and easy breakfast option. You can customize them with your favorite vegetables and cheese. They are perfect for busy mornings or meal prep.

To make these cups, start by whisking eggs in a bowl.

Add in chopped vegetables like spinach, bell peppers, or cherry tomatoes. You can also mix in cheese for extra flavor.

Next, pour the egg mixture into a greased muffin tin, filling each cup about three-quarters full.

Bake at 350°F (180°C) for about 20-25 minutes, until the eggs are set.

These frittata cups are delicious warm or cold. They store well in the fridge, making them great for snacks too.

Ingredients:

  • 6 large eggs
  • 1 cup of chopped vegetables
  • 1/2 cup of shredded cheese
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Cooking spray or oil for greasing

Cooking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(180°C).
  2. Whisk the eggs in a bowl.
  3. Stir in chopped vegetables and cheese.
  4. Grease a muffin tin with cooking spray.
  5. Pour the mixture into each muffin cup.
  6. Bake for 20-25 minutes until set.

2) Mini Meatloaf Muffins

A muffin pan filled with mini meatloaf muffins, fresh from the oven, surrounded by herbs and spices

Mini meatloaf muffins are a fun twist on the classic dish. They are perfect for a quick dinner or meal prep. You can customize them with your favorite ingredients.

To make them, use ground beef or turkey combined with breadcrumbs and spices. These muffins cook quickly and are easy to serve.

Top them with ketchup for added flavor or glaze them with BBQ sauce for a tasty finish.

With their individual portions, they make for great lunch box meals too. Kids enjoy them, and they reheat well.

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ef or turkey
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1/4 cup ketchup (plus extra for topping)
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• 1/2 onion, finely chopped
  • 1 egg, beaten

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a bowl, mix all ingredients until well combined.
  3. Spoon the mixture into a greased muffin pan.
  4. Bake for 20-25 minutes until cooked through.
  5. Optional: Top with extra ketchup before serving.

3) Jalapeno Cheddar Bites

A muffin pan filled with golden, puffy Jalapeno Cheddar Bites fresh from the oven

Jalapeno Cheddar Bites are a tasty treat you can easily make using a muffin pan. These bites are packed with flavor, combining the kick of jalapeños with the richness of cheddar cheese.

To start, you’ll need to prepare your muffin tin by greasing it well.

Layer some shredded cheddar at the bottom, followed by a mix of cream cheese, bacon, and diced jalapeños. Finish off with another layer of cheddar on top for a delicious crust.

Bake these in an oven preheated to 400°F (200°C) until they are golden and bubbly. Let them cool slightly before enjoying!

Ingredients

  • 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up cream cheese
  • 1 cup cooked bacon, chopped
  • 2-3 jalapeños, diced
  • Cooking spray

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Grease a muffin tin with cooking spray.
  3. Add a layer of cheddar cheese at the bottom of each cup.
  4. Mix cream cheese, bacon, and jalapeños; place this mixture in the cups.
  5. Top with more cheddar cheese.
  6. Bake for 15-20 minutes until golden brown.
  7. Let cool and serve.

4) Mini Mac and Cheese Cups

A muffin pan filled with mini mac and cheese cups, golden brown and bubbling with melted cheese on top

Mini Mac and Cheese Cups are a fun twist on the classic comfort food. They are great for parties or as a quick snack. You can make them in a mini muffin pan for easy serving.

These cups are cheesy and have a crispy top, making them irresistible. You can customize the recipe with your favorite types of cheese or add extras like bacon or vegetables.

Ingredients

  • 1 cup elbow macaroni
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1 egg
  • 1/2 cup bread crumbs
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Cook macaroni according to package directions and drain.
  3. In a bowl, mix macaroni, cheese, milk, egg, salt, and pepper.
  4. Spoon the mixture into a greased mini muffin pan.
  5. Top each cup with bread crumbs.
  6. Bake for 15-20 minutes until golden brown.

5) Blueberry Pie Tassies

A muffin pan filled with freshly baked blueberry pie tassies

Blueberry pie tassies are a delightful treat you can easily make in a muffin pan. These mini pies are filled with juicy blueberries and have a buttery crust that everyone loves. They’re perfect for sharing at parties or as a sweet snack.

To start, you’ll need a mini muffin tin. This ensures each tassie holds its shape and cooks evenly.

The combination of the fruit filling and the flaky crust creates a delicious bite-sized dessert.

You can add a sprinkle of cinnamon on top for extra flavor. A drizzle of glaze also makes them look extra special. These blueberry pie tassies are sure to be a hit with your friends and family.

Ingredients

  • 1 package of pie crust (or homemade)
  • 1 cup fresh blueberries
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on (optional)
  • Glaze (optional)

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Roll out the pie crust and cut it into small circles.
  3. Place each circle into a mini muffin tin.
  4. In a bowl, mix blueberries, sugar, lemon juice, and cornstarch.
  5. Fill each crust with the blueberry mixture.
  6. Sprinkle cinnamon on top if desired.
  7. Bake for 20-25 minutes until golden brown.
  8. Allow to cool and drizzle with glaze if using. Enjoy!

6) Cheesy Bacon Egg Muffins

A muffin pan filled with Cheesy Bacon Egg Muffins, fresh from the oven, sitting on a rustic wooden table

Cheesy bacon egg muffins are a simple and delicious breakfast option. They’re easy to make and perfect for busy mornings or a cozy weekend brunch. You only need a few ingredients to bring this recipe to life.

You’ll mix eggs, cooked bacon, shredded cheese, salt, and pepper.

Pour this mixture into a greased muffin tin and bake in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 12 to 15 minutes.

These muffins are tasty and versatile. Feel free to add veggies or herbs if you like. They taste great fresh out of the oven or even reheated!

Ingredients

  • 6 large eggs
  • 4 slices cooked bacon, chopped
  • 1 cup shredded cheese (your choice)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ional: chopped vegetables or herbs

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Grease your muffin tin lightly.
  3. In a bowl, beat the eggs until fluffy.
  4. Add chopped bacon, cheese, salt, and pepper.
  5. Pour the mixture into the muffin cups.
  6. Bake for 12 to 15 minutes until set.
  7. Let cool slightly before serving.

7) Mini Chicken Pot Pies

A muffin pan filled with mini chicken pot pies, golden brown and steaming hot, fresh out of the oven

Mini chicken pot pies are a fun and tasty dish you can make in a muffin pan. They are perfect for a quick meal or a snack.

To start, you can use pre-made crescent roll dough for the crust. This makes the process easier and quicker.

Just spoon your chicken mixture into each dough-lined muffin cup, filling them about halfway.

Bake them at 375°F (190°C) for 18-20 minutes until they are golden brown. The result is a warm, comforting dish that the whole family will love.

Ingredients

  • 1 can of crescent roll dough
  • 2 cups shredded cooked chicken
  • 1 cup mixed vegetables (like peas and carrots)
  • 1 can cream of chicken soup
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Prepare a muffin pan by spraying it with cooking spray.
  3. Unroll the crescent roll dough and place it into each muffin cup.
  4. In a bowl, mix chicken, vegetables, soup, salt, and pepper.
  5. Spoon the mixture into each cup.
  6. Bake for 18-20 minutes until golden brown.
  7. Let them cool slightly before serving. Enjoy!

8) Pizza Bombs

A muffin pan filled with pizza bombs, fresh out of the oven, bubbling with melted cheese and savory fillings

Pizza bombs are a fun and tasty treat. They are perfect for parties or a cozy family night. You get all the flavors of pizza stuffed into a soft dough.

To make them, you can use store-bought pizza dough. Fill it with your favorite ingredients like pepperoni, cheese, and pizza sauce. Then, roll them up and bake until golden.

You can serve these delicious bites with extra pizza sauce for dipping. Enjoy experimenting with different fillings!

Ingredients

  • 1 package pizza dough
  • 1 cup pizza sauce
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1 cup pepperoni slices
  • 2 tablespoons melted butter
  • 1 tablespoon Italian seasoning

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Roll out the pizza dough and cut it into squares.
  3. Place a spoonful of pizza sauce, cheese, and pepperoni on each square.
  4. Fold the dough over the filling and pinch to seal.
  5. Brush the tops with melted butter and sprinkle with Italian seasoning.
  6. Bake for 15-20 minutes or until golden brown.

9) Crustless Pizza Cups

A muffin pan filled with crustless pizza cups, topped with cheese and pepperoni, fresh out of the oven

Crustless Pizza Cups are a fun and easy snack or meal option. You can make them using a muffin pan, which helps create perfect little portions.

They are tasty and simple to customize with your favorite toppings.

To start, pre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).

Line a muffin tin with slices of pepperoni, salami, or Canadian bacon, which will act as the crust.

Next, add your favorite pizza toppings, such as cheese, olives, or bell peppers.

Then, you can bake them for about 10 to 15 minutes until the cheese is melted and bubbly.

They are great for a quick dinner or a party appetizer. Enjoy these delicious bites fresh from the oven!

Ingredients:

  • Pepperoni, salami, or Canadian bacon
  • Shredded cheese
  • Pizza toppings (like olives or bell peppers)

Cooking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Line muffin cups with meat slices.
  3. Add your favorite toppings.
  4. Bake for 10-15 minutes until cheese is melted.

10) Sushi Cups

A muffin pan filled with sushi cups, arranged on a wooden serving board

Sushi cups are a fun twist on traditional sushi. Using a muffin pan, you can easily create these delicious individual servings. They are perfect for parties or a quick meal.

To start, prepare sticky rice and nori sheets. You’ll shape the rice in muffin tins and add your favorite sushi fillings.

Cubed salmon, avocado, and vegetables make great choices.

Bake them in a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C) for a crispy bottom. After a few minutes, let them cool slightly before serving.

Ingredients

  • Nori sheets
  • Sticky rice
  • Cubed salmon or other protein
  • Soy sauce
  • Optional vegetables (such as avocado or cucumber)

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Cut nori sheets into squares and place them in a muffin tin.
  3. Add sticky rice to each nori cup, pressing down gently.
  4. Top with cubed salmon and veggies.
  5. Bake for about 10-12 minutes.
  6. Let cool before removing from the tin.
